The Assistant Project Manager assists in profitably managing all administrative and field construction activities related to assigned projects. The Assistant Project Manager typically reports to the Project Manager.
Essential Job Duties & Responsibilities:
- Profitably manages a small project individually, or a larger project with a Project Managerâs oversight
- Assists with creating and updating the project schedule
- Negotiates, issues and executes subcontract and vendor change orders within delegated authority
- Prices and negotiates owner change orders within delegated authority
- Approves subcontractor and vendor pay applications
- Assists in the preconstruction and buy-out processes
- Drafts accurate scopes of work to be included in subcontracts and/or purchase order agreements
- Assists in the preparation and implementation of the project plan and updates
- Monitors material and equipment deliveries/shipping commitments to ensure project team is aware of status and potential project schedule impacts
- Ensures subcontract agreements and amendments are issued and follow up if necessary
- Understands contract terms and obligations to ensure work in progress is within scope
- Assists in the resolution of issues with subcontractors, vendors, architects and owners
- Contributes to ensuring project completion is on time or ahead of schedule with the expected level of profitability
- Oversees RFI process if necessary; coordinates with project team; verifies impact and pricing
- Completes monthly project status reports (MPSR), owner billings and financial risk assessments
- Assists with project proposals and presentations as requested
- Performs other duties as assigned
Essential Skills:
To perform the job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each previously stated duty satisfactorily. The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skills, and ability necessary to succeed in this role.
- Education: industry-related college degree is required; an equivalent combination of education and experience will be considered.
- Experience: A minimum of five years of construction experience is preferred. Three years of construction management experience is required. Experience as an Owners Representative is a plus
- Skills: Attention to detail, time management, judgment, communication, solid leadership, client relations, negotiation, project management, solid construction knowledge, decision-making, conflict resolution, tact, adaptable, problem solving, personal initiative and analytical abilities are all necessary skills for an Assistant Project Manager.
- Technology: Candidate should have experience with or be able to learn specific project management and scheduling software (ex: JDE, Procore, Bluebeam, Asta).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ite is required. Training will be provided on company standards.
